Husband Says I Can Have the Property and Hassle?

Question of the Day:

Me and my husband want a divorce. We have rental properties that are currently under rent to own agreements. If he is willing to let me have them is that a issue? I have done all work to acquire and keep these properties. he has no interest in them and said i could have the hassle. – Tara

Answer:

Tara: The Court will usually approve the agreement of the parties, as long as it is in writing and signed.
